TEDx Talks - Performing Original Song: Haiku | Adam Jones | TEDxSanDiego
The transcript presents a poetic exploration of a character's internal battle with memories and identity. It describes the character's journey through past regrets and the challenge of rising above them. The narrative uses vivid imagery, such as 'whiskey,' 'battles,' and 'lonely nights,' to convey the depth of the character's emotional state. The character grapples with whether to succumb to despair or rise again, reflecting on past victories and failures. The poem suggests that memories, once cherished, can become burdensome, and the character must decide whether to let these memories define him or to overcome them. The recurring question of whether to 'sink deeper or rise up again' highlights the theme of resilience and the struggle for self-redemption.
